Indian traditions instantly relate to Guru with the 'Shloka' ..
गुरुर्ब्रह्मा गुरुर्विष्णुः गुरुर्देवो महेश्‍वरः । 
गुरु साक्षात्‌ परब्रह्म तस्मै श्रीगुरुवे नमः ॥
Guru is truly godly. The general interpretation is that Guru is akin to the three highest divine energies and we offer salutation to the Guru.
However; this 'Shloka' has a much deeper meaning. It is the a true perspective for self-awakening of all sentient beings…
गुरुर्ब्रह्मा -Brahma (Creative powers of the existence) is your Guru
गुरुर्विष्णुः –Vishnu (Sustaining powers of the existence ) is your Guru
गुरुर्देवो महेश्‍वरः – Shiva (Supreme Godly energy of emergence and reformation) is you Guru.
गुरु साक्षात्‌ परब्रह्म – The supreme powers, concept and laws which are beyond everything is your guru.
तस्मै श्रीगुरुवे नम- Salutations to that guru empowered by ‘Shri’- The supreme powerful energy responsible for the evolution, sustenance and dissolution of all.
The 'Shloka' is in fact an appeal to all individuals to seek intrinsic guidance which originates from the ‘Supreme’ knowing of the world – which is everyone’s Guru. Rest all are divine gateways to ‘That’.
